Rooflights, also known as skylights, are windows installed in the roof of a building to allow natural light to enter from above. They come in a variety of shapes and sizes, from small rectangular windows to large, expansive panels that can flood a room with sunlight. Rooflights are a popular choice for spaces that lack traditional windows or for rooms where additional light is desired. They can be installed in flat or pitched roofs, and are often used in spaces such as kitchens, living rooms, and offices to create a bright, airy atmosphere.
One of the main benefits of rooflights is their ability to improve the energy efficiency of a building. By allowing natural light to enter, rooflights can reduce the need for artificial lighting during the day, lowering energy consumption and decreasing utility bills. In addition, natural light is known to have a positive impact on mental health and well-being, promoting a sense of calm and reducing stress levels. Studies have shown that exposure to natural light can improve mood, productivity, and overall health, making rooflights a valuable addition to any space.
Lanterns are another popular choice for bringing natural light into a room. These are often installed on flat roofs or as part of an extension, offering a stylish and contemporary alternative to traditional skylights. Lanterns are typically constructed with a frame of steel or aluminum and feature multiple glass panels that allow light to enter from all angles. They can be customized in a variety of shapes and sizes to suit the unique design of a space, making them a versatile option for creating a statement feature in a room.
In addition to their aesthetic appeal, lanterns provide many of the same benefits as rooflights in terms of energy efficiency and well-being. Like rooflights, lanterns can reduce the need for artificial lighting and enhance the overall ambiance of a space. Their sleek and modern design adds a touch of elegance to any room, making them a popular choice for contemporary homes and commercial buildings.
When choosing between rooflights and lanterns, there are several factors to consider. The size and shape of the space, as well as the orientation of the building, will influence the type of natural light solution that is most suitable. Rooflights are ideal for rooms with sloped ceilings or limited wall space, while lanterns work well in larger, open-plan areas that require a statement feature. Both options can be customized with features such as remote-controlled blinds or ventilation systems to enhance their functionality and comfort.
